The upcoming Beast of G-Unit album has been buzzing since a set of exclusive listening events popped. Thankfully the band of brothers is not skimping on promo, most recently sitting down with XXL for an interview where G-Unit Says Things Will Never Fall Apart Between Them Again. Dropping wisdom, science, facts and behind the scenes info, the take-away is the collective album release will follow with solo releases from every member. Though 50 is taking a step back as far as the actual music for the group release, his solo work is said to be first up after it! Tony Yayo notes “it’s different being an independent than being a major. We all got a lot of music, we need to drop it.”

As far as the hate Yayo notes:

“I mean, I’m used to hate. I feel like with the success of G-Unit, it was so big so fast in a rapid time we was on top, I feel we still are on top. But it’s like, we didn’t really get along with everybody cause you know…50 had a lot of issue with people. So it was different for us. I know there’s going to be hate, and there’s gonna be resistance, but you just fight through that. Nah mean, keep making music and sh*t…”

Lloyd Banks elaborates on keeping his mind right:

“I actually use the negative comments from ’07, ’08–cause that’s when the resistance really started for me, cause my album was like, me and Mobb Deep kind of kicked off that recession year. I was adjusting to it the same way the fans were…I started to hear things ‘aww he’s done…’ and I would go through those comments and use that for my fuel. And slowly but surely you see people apologizing.”

Even relative new-comer Kidd Kidd went through it:

“Awww man I went through that when I was coming up!…’oh he’s wack, he’s this and that…’ Got on Hot 97, showing people what I could do you know…but at the end of the day it wasn’t nothing but people opening up their ears. Then once they opened their ears I got the same type of apologies: ‘Yo Kidd I’m so sorry I slept on you…'”
